That’s what marketing research tries to accomplish. Exactly what is marketing research? Marketing research is nothing more than the means by which a company gathers data through a variety of media to be used for strategic business purposes like sales.
Marketing research surveying is a strategy employed by researchers to collect significant data from groups or populations in relation to a product or service and acts as the de facto count on general opinion.
With the use of the Internet, companies can readily conduct online marketing research tactics which allow them to get inside the minds of their customers and know exactly what they want and how best to deliver it. Other tactics include customer satisfaction research, concept testing, and product introductions all of which serve to provide the companies with reliable data which helps them decide whether a product is acceptable or not and if it merits continuation.
Simply put, online marketing research is the means by which companies gather information regarding the wants, needs, and peeves of customers to better improve their marketing output.Marketing research data gathered with the use of questioning is classified as qualitative and quantitative marketing data, the former being data gathered from a select source which does not reflect the wants or opinions of the public as whole, and the latter being data which is used to surmise what the public ‘generally’ wants.
